If you are a proven leader, enjoy building relationships, and providing support to your team and clients, then a role as a Business Relationship Manager Area Manager is for you.

As an Area Manager in Business Banking, you'll lead a team of Business Relationship Managers (BRM) in developing new business and deepening existing relationships to position JPMorgan Chase as the primary bank for our clients.

Job responsibilities

  • Provide leadership, management, support, direction, and guidance to a team of Business Relationship Managers within a territory in developing new deposit, cash management, and credit business while focusing on relationship‑building, client experience, and risk management.
  • Manage performance of individual team members, holding all Business Relationship Managers accountable for achieving business priorities with a focus on client experience and risk management.
  • Manage the area’s revenue and profitability and monitor adherence to credit quality, regulatory requirements, and risk protocols; utilize reporting and metrics to monitor team performance, identify trends, and address or escape issues in a timely manner.
  • Coach and develop team on all aspects of managing a portfolio, including relationship management, prospecting, profitability, client experience, and risk management; provide expertise to team on loan structuring, pricing, and developing customized solutions; help team identify solutions to complex challenges.
  • Hold Business Relationship Managers accountable for understanding the personal financial goals and needs of their business clients and connecting them with specialists who can help meet their financial needs.
  • Build collaborative relationships with partners across lines of business – Chase Wealth Management, Home Lending, Branch Teams, Commercial Bank, and Private Bank – to foster a One Chase, client‑centric environment and represent the bank in a community leadership capacity such as Chamber of Commerce and local non‑profit boards.
  • Actively recruit and maintain a pipeline of diverse viable candidates; select, hire, develop and retain top quality talent by creating an inclusive and respectful team environment.

Required qualifications, capabilities, and skills

  • Minimum of 7 years’ experience in a Business Banking Relationship Management role or related business lending experience; direct in‑person contact required.
  • Expert knowledge of deposit and cash management products and services and expert knowledge of business credit underwriting with commercial credit training.
  • Strong communication skills with individuals at all levels, internally and externally.
  • Analyze reports, metrics, and other data to identify trends, issues, and opportunities.
  • Proven ability to build collaborative relationships across the organization and influence others to achieve desired outcomes, and the ability to lead proactively through change; strong current business network; viewed as a leader in community organizations with demonstrated business acumen.
  • Balance needs of clients with associated risks and interests of the firm, and consistently use a disciplined process to manage time; use time strategically to balance long‑term and day‑to‑day demands of management role.
  • Travel occasionally for key business and leadership meetings and training.

Preferred qualifications, capabilities, and skills

  • Bachelor’s degree in Finance or related field or equivalent work experience.
  • Prior experience in managing a relationship development team.
  • Highly proficient in Microsoft Office tools including Outlook, Excel, Word, and PowerPoint.
